1940 Richard and Maurice McDonald opened McDonalds Bar-B-Q restaurant

on Fourteenth and E streets in San Bernardino, California. It is a typical drive-


in featuring a large menu and car hop service.

1948 Dick and Mac McDonald shut down their restaurant for three months for
alterations. In December it reopened as a self-service drive-in restaurant. The
menu is reduced to nine items: hamburger, cheeseburger, soft drinks, milk,
coffee, potato chips and a slice of pie. The staple of the menu is the 15 cent
hamburger. Speedee became the company symbol in December, 1948.
Speedee was a miniature animated chef.

1954 Multimixer salesman Ray Kroc visited MDonalds in San Bernardino intending
to sell the brothers more Multimixers. The 52 year old Kroc is fascinated by
the operation. He learned from the brothers that they are looking for a
nationwide franchising agent. He has an epiphany and is determined that his
future would be in hamburgers.

1955 Kroc opened his first McDonalds in Des Plaines, Illinois on April 15. The
attention getting red and white tiled building with the Golden Arches was
designed by architect Stanley Meston in 1953. First day sales are $366.12. By
1965 there would be over 700 McDonalds restaurants throughout the United
States.

1961 Hamburger University opens in the basement of the Elk Grove Village, Illinois,
McDonalds restaurant. Graduates receive Bachelor of Hamburgerology
degrees.

A modemistic Golden Arches logo inspired by the McDonalds red and white
building slanted roof replaces Speedee as the companys logo. Ray Kroc
purchased the interest of the McDonald brothers along with rights to the
McDonalds name for $2.7 million.

1965 McDonalds celebrates its 10th anniversary with the first public stock offering
at $2250 per share.

1967 The first international McDonalds restaurants opened in Canada and Puerto
Rico. Today McDonalds are in 119 countries around the world.

1969 The McDonalds logo underwent a major change. Massive remodeling of


restaurants did away with the old red and white buildings and more emphasis
was placed on the ever-more-famous Golden Arches.

1981 The first McDonalds restaurants in Spain, Denmark, and the Philippines
opened.

1998 The Made For You kitchen operating platform rolled out into U.S.
restaurants, allowing for greater customization of our meu items & more
kitchen flexibility. Made For You is now the common operating platform used
in McDonalds kitchens around the globe.

2003 McDonalds strategic framework, the Plan To Win, is launched. Through the
execution of initiatives focusing on People, Products, Place, Price and
Promotion, we have enhanced the restaurant experience worldwide and
grown comparable sales & customer visits in each of the last nine years.

First global ad campaign, Im lovin it, is launched in Munich, Germany on


September 2.

2008 McDonalds introduces the most comprehensive global packaging design in


the Brands History.

2010 McDonalds offers its customers free Wi-Fi in more than 28, 000 McDonalds
restaurants around the world.
